The values for S1, S2, T1, and T2 are configurable.
In abnormal operating conditions; that is, when a blade thermal sensor is approaching or
crossed its upper non-critical threshold, the SAM automatically adjusts the fan speeds to a point
where all the blade thermal sensors are just below their upper non-critical threshold (minus a
user configurable offset).
The dynamic minimum fan level is not used.
Each fan tray has six fan units and each fan unit has an inlet and outlet fan. Fan speeds for all
level settings are summarized in the next table.

Redundancy Control
The ShMM-1500R supports redundant operation with automatic switchover using a redundant
ShMM-1500R. In a configuration where two ShMM-1500Rs are present, one acts as the active
shelf manager and the other as a standby. Both ShMM-1500Rs monitor each other, and either
can trigger a switchover if necessary.
The ShMM-1500R provides a number of hardware redundancy signals on the CN1 connector.
The HRI is implemented using the FPGA device.
